It was centuries ago when men started putting up various forms of structures. Their output, however, were made mostly out of wood, bricks, and stones.
After some time, the introduction of technology allowed the creation of stronger and sturdier buildings. For example, one of the most useful machines ever invented was the timber crane. This contraption is capable of lifting a considerable amount of weight as well as reaching out to great heights; thus making the working process a lot easier and faster.
Eventually, the supplies used in establishing structures evolved as well. This can be owed to the development of materials such as glass, concrete, and metal. By incorporating these items into the construction process, edifices are now more capable of withstanding various sorts of calamities and natural disasters.
Through the years, experts have made different kinds of buildings such as residential, commercial, and industrial types. Most of these have been touched by modern cultural influences and were meticulously planned to accommodate the distinct needs of society. Skyscrapers, condominiums, and big establishments, for instance, reveal the enormous development in this industry.
